HBO Max has finally spread its wings outside the USA. Today, 29th June, the streaming service has launched in 39 territories in Latin America and the Caribbean. It is the first venture out of the USA for the WarnerMedia-owned streaming service.
Here’s all you need to know –
Countries where HBO Max has launched today –
HBO Max has launched in the following Latin American and Caribbean countries: Anguilla, Antigua, Argentina, Aruba, Bahamas, Barbados, Belize, Bolivia, Brazil, British Virgin Islands, Cayman Islands, Chile, Colombia, Costa Rica, Curacao, Dominica, Dominican Republic, Ecuador, El Salvador, Grenada, Guatemala, Guyana, Haiti, Honduras, Jamaica, Mexico, Montserrat, Nicaragua, Panama, Paraguay, Peru, St. Kitts and Nevis, St. Lucia, St. Vincent, Suriname, Trinidad and Tobago, Turks and Caicos, Uruguay and Venezuela.
Cost of HBO Max subscription in these countries –
HBO Max is offering two subscription plans in Latin America and the Caribbean –
A “Standard Plan”, which allows 3 simultaneous users, 5 personalized profiles, content downloads, video in high definition, with some titles in 4K, across all supported devices.
A cheaper “Mobile Only Plan”, which allows only a single user, with standard definition stream. The content available to watch on this plan is same as that of the Standard Plan.
Subscription rates start from as low as $3 a month, with discounts for quarterly and annual subscriptions. HBO Max is also offering a seven-day free trial in these countries.
Examples of subscription rates in some countries –
Argentina – Standard – ARS 529/month
Mobile – ARS 359/month
Brazil – Standard – R$ 28,00/month Mobile – R$ 19,97/month
Mexico – Standard – MXN 149/month
Mobile – MXN 99/month
For comparison sake, Mexico subscription rates in Indian Rupees are Standard- ₹559/month and ₹371/month
Content library at launch –
All the older content available on HBO Max USA, including shows like Friends, The Big Bang Theory, Fresh Prince Of Bel-Air, among others.
All HBO shows such as Game Of Thrones, Succession, Chernobyl, Band Of Brothers, Watchmen, among others.
All Max Originals, such as The Flight Attendant, Raised By Wolves, among others.
Locally commissioned content such as Pop Divas, The Cut, Las Bravas, among others.
UEFA Champions League matches until 2024, in Brazil and Mexico
All new Warner Bros films will be available for streaming 35 days after their release in local theatres. HBO Max in Latin America and the Caribbean will not offer same day streaming of new films such as Dune and The Suicide Squad, as in the US.
